Thanks were given at the Tomaree Community Hospital Auxiliary's Christmas luncheon in Nelson Bay last week.

At the luncheon, auxiliary president Pauline Parrish presented Max Harman, chairman of Nelson Bay Bowling Club's board, with a certificate of appreciation for its support of the group's fund-raising activities throughout the year.
The event was described as a "fun day" with "lots of cheer, laughter and delicious lunch to end the year".
Auxiliary members are dedicated volunteers who raise funds used to purchase much needed equipment on the Nelson Bay hospital's wishlist. Publicity officer Deborah Schofield said the auxiliary offered residents an opportunity to help the hospital.
"If you enjoy sewing, knitting, or doing any craft join the auxiliary. You will catch up with like-minded ladies, have a chat, go to lunch and raise money for your local hospital," she said.
